Chemical energy is stored in the bonds between atoms and molecules within a substance. When these bonds are broken through a chemical reaction, the stored energy is released.
Chemical energy is converted to light energy in a chemical reaction called chemiluminescence. An example is the reaction between a chemiluminescent substance like luminol and hydrogen peroxide, which produces light without the need for heat or electricity. Another example is the combustion of magnesium in air, which releases energy in the form of light.

The amount of chemical energy a substance has is determined by the types and arrangement of atoms and molecules in that substance. The energy is stored within the chemical bonds between these atoms and molecules. The strength of these bonds and the potential energy stored in them determine the amount of chemical energy.

The total amount of energy a substance contains can be quantified by its internal energy, which includes both the kinetic energy of its molecules (related to temperature) and potential energy from intermolecular forces. This total energy is influenced by factors such as temperature, pressure, and chemical composition.
